To navigate your way to … WebNov 24, 2024 · A pericyclic reaction is a reaction in which bonds form or break at the termini of one or more conjugated π systems. The electrons move around in a circle, all bonds are made and broken simultaneously, and no intermediates intervene. The requirement of concertedness distinguishes pericyclic reactions from most polar or free-radical …
